What You’ll Do

Explore the ingredients and flavors that make cuisine in the south of France so stunning.

Chef Cregg knows that being a good cook is about more than following recipes; it's really all about technique. In this interactive cooking class, you'll handcraft four traditional French recipes completely from scratch.

Learn all about the south of France and it's rustic cuisine as you prepare a crisp salad of haricots verts, shallots, mustard and tarragon. Then, make fried potato puffs with mushrooms, and a peppery brandy sauce for your pan-seared steak. End with a French classic for dessert: CrГЄpes with an orange reduction.

Guests are welcome to bring wine and beer to enjoy during the class.

With over 20 years of culinary experience gained in various cities and restaurants across the country, Chef Cregg has now found his niche as a food stylist and chef instructor. His blend of geographical cooking styles span the global epicurean gamut. From contemporary Californian to fusion BBQ to classic Caribbean and more, Chef Cregg's modern techniques and use of simple, seasonal ingredients are sure to impress.
